Viktig information
- Rekommenderas inte för resenärer med låg kardiovaskulär hälsa
- Rekommenderas ej för gravida resenärer
- Servicedjur tillåtna
- Lämplig för alla fysiska konditionsnivåer
- Deltagarna måste fylla i PADI Diver Medical Questionnaire (tillgängligt via oss eller online), och vid behov ha sin läkares sign-off som indikerar att det är säkert att delta
- Deltagare får inte resa till mer än 1000ft höjd under 18 timmar efter denna aktivitet (inklusive interisland och kommersiella flygningar, helikopterturer, fallskärmshoppning och resor till Waimea Canyon)
- Vänligen läs och fyll i formulären i din e-postbekräftelse omedelbart, eftersom det inte kommer att ges någon återbetalning inom 24 timmar efter din upplevelse om du misslyckas med att fylla i dessa framgångsrikt, vilket kan kräva en läkares godkännande.

Well I wish I could tell you something great about this adventure, but I wouldn't know because we never made it. They send tlla medical release the day before. NOTE: well after the 24-hour refundable cancelation period has passed. If you are over 45, on meds, and a few other things you have to have a physician's release, which would be easy to get if they sent they form when booked - 3 weeks ago. BUT dont worry, they have a doctor you can call and pay another $200 that will release you over the phone! So here is my issue with that: you can't take my word that I'm a healthy 55 YO, but if I pay your doctor $200 send him my ID and give him my pulse he can tell you that I'm healthy enough for this excursion! How can that be when he has never even seen me? Furthermore, how is that even legal or actually safe? So, if you are over 45 and are looking forward to this adventure, like we were, reach out in advance so you can get an actual medical release and enjoy yourself, instead of being stressed out and pressured to use their doc-in-box, which we did not do, because as stated above it doesn't sound ethically sound.
